Verse 27: Prophesy[edit]

This verse seems to state that Ether would be alive with Coriantumr when he is found in the book of Omni. But then in the last chapter of Ether, it states that all of the Lords words had been fulfilled, yet i still don't see how Ether saw the Nephites possess this land. Does anyone have any insight into this passage? --Tyboojwa 14 Apr 2006

Good question. Ether 15:33 says that Ether wrote that "the words of the Lord had all been fulfilled" and yet Ether doesn't witness (or at least mention) that Coriantumr saw "another people receiving the land"—this prophesy seems to be fulfilled in Omni 1:26, but Ether doesn't mention it.
One view might be that when Ether "beheld that the words of the Lord had all been fulfilled" (Ether 15:34), Ether witnessed the people of Zarahemla discover Coriantumr. This is reading a bit into the text, but would seem to resolve the issue. Another view might be that the prophecy in verse 21 only consists of the first sentence—that Coriantumr's household would all be destroyed except himself—and that the rest of the verse is an editorial comment by a later redactor.
